About the Role

The Sr. Analyst, Client Due Diligence (CDD) is responsible for executing and supporting Visa’s client due diligence and acceptance program in accordance with global AML, ATF, and Sanctions policies and procedures. The role involves conducting complex CDD and EDD reviews, performing ongoing monitoring activities, leading teams and providing subject matter expertise to internal stakeholders and clients. This role also performs secondary reviews, quality assurance checks, and provides constructive feedback and guidance to team members to ensure consistency, accuracy, and regulatory compliance.
